For largegauge electronic charging cables—especially 50mm² shielded cables—production demands strong cutting force, precise shield removal, and consistent insulation stripping. Traditional manual or multiprocess machines struggle with thick conductors and dense braided shields, resulting in unstable output and high defect rates. This is why more manufacturers adopt an allinone machine combining shield stripping, insulation stripping, and cable cutting to boost productivity and ensure uniform quality.
1. Why 50mm² Shielded Cables Require an Integrated Processing Machine
• Large crosssection requires clean, highforce cutting
A 50mm² conductor is thick and rigid. Standard machines often fail to perform a clean cut, leaving burrs or partial breaks. The integrated machine uses a hightorque servo system to produce a single, smooth cut without deforming the conductor.
•Dense braided shielding is difficult to remove
This cable type typically features tight copper braiding. Shield removal must be deep enough to separate the braid yet gentle enough to preserve the insulation below. The dedicated allinone system calculates depth and controls blade pressure precisely, delivering clean, even shieldcut lines.
•Multistation processing increases errors
If cutting, stripping, and shield removal are handled by separate machines, strip lengths and cable lengths can drift. Integrated processing keeps all parameters synchronized, ensuring every finished cable matches the required specification.
2. Key Capabilities of the Recommended AllinOne Machine (Wholesale Model)
1). Hightorque cutting module
Engineered for cables 50mm² and above, it produces flat, accurate cuts without conductor distortion.
2). Intelligent layered stripping function
The machine allows independent settings for shield removal, outer jacket stripping, and inner insulation stripping, achieving clear separation of each layer.
3). Fullservo synchronized motion
Cut length, strip length, and pulloff speed are digitally controlled. This ensures stable, repeatable performance for highvolume batches.
4). Multirecipe quickchange system
For wholesalers handling diverse cable specifications, stored presets enable fast switching without mechanical adjustments.
